There’s a new meme being shared widely this week across social media accounts in Colombia‘s capital Bogota, as the city grapples with a water crisis.

It’s an image of C Montgomery Burns, the supervillain from the animated series The Simpsons, showing up at the door with a bunch of red roses and a heart-shaped chocolate box.

Smiling, he says: “I saw your turn at water rationing is different from mine”.

The rationing came into effect on Thursday morning. Bogota and dozens of surrounding towns have been divided into nine different zones with domestic running water cut off for 24 hours in each zone on a rotation that will reset every 10 days. The measures will affect approximately 9 million people.

There are contingency plans to ensure schools and hospitals have a continuous supply, authorities have said.
